Okatakyie Afrifa Mensah Describes Ga Youth Who Stormed His Workplace As Spineless Cowards

Ghanaian broadcaster Okatakyie Afrifa-Mensah has responded to the Ga Youth who stormed the premises of Angel FM/TV in Accra, demanding an apology from him.

The youth were upset over comments Afrifa-Mensah made about the Gborbu Wulumo of the Nungua Traditional Council several months ago.

Although Afrifa-Mensah had already apologized to the Traditional Council, the Ga Youth still sought him out at his workplace, claiming he had disrespected their tribe and culture.

However, when they arrived at the station, they were informed that Afrifa-Mensah was not present.

Afrifa-Mensah took to social media to express his disdain for the group, describing them as “spineless cowards.” He pointed out that he works from 6 am to 10 am, but the group arrived at the station at 1:30 pm, long after he had finished his shift.

“Mo y3 normal?” Afrifa-Mensah asked in a post, which translates to “Are they normal?” He accompanied the post with the hashtag “#zombies,” implying that the group’s actions were irrational and bizarre.

The incident has sparked a heated debate, with some defending Okatakyie Afrifa Mensah’s right to free speech and others condemning his comments as disrespectful. The Ga Youth’s actions have also been criticized, with many questioning their motives and tactics.
